Output 676231ec9ea416c5a749fc17b7aa85c49829d2a906745fbbf0e3f14ea471b650:1

value
365188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2b487aaab444f8ed335229fb335d37cc483e77 OP_EQUAL
address
3HUeg6RwebmUe4xqDCsh19r5ZHSowmNtp8
transaction
676231ec9ea416c5a749fc17b7aa85c49829d2a906745fbbf0e3f14ea471b650
confirmations
85909
spent
true